Structural Drying & Dehumidification
This is the phase San Pedro’s climate makes harder and more important than almost anywhere in the LA Basin. The persistent marine layer keeps relative humidity high through most of the year, so structural drying times run longer than inland neighborhoods. We set up Dri-Eaz dehumidifiers and Phoenix air movers to hit targeted drying goals, then take daily readings until the dry standard is met - not a day before. In plaster-and-lath Craftsman cottages near Averill Park, that patience prevents the hidden moisture problem that triggers mold regrowth months later.

Common Water Damage Restoration Problems We See in San Pedro Homes
- Salt-driven corrosion hiding behind walls. The dual exposure of Pacific salt air and port-bound diesel particulate pre-degrades structural metals in San Pedro homes. By the time a pipe bursts, fasteners and nail plates have often lost half their cross-section, turning a small extraction into a structural repair.
- Plaster-and-lath walls holding moisture longer. Homes built in the 1910s through 1940s retain water in original plaster and lath far longer than modern drywall. Without extended structural drying time and daily moisture readings, mold colonies establish quickly in San Pedro’s humid marine air.
- Original plumbing at the edge of failure. Galvanized supply lines in Craftsman bungalows and port-worker cottages are often sixty to a hundred years old. A repair on one section can expose adjacent weak points, so proper restoration means checking what the water traveled through, not just where it pooled.
- Storm-surge and tidal backflow in low-lying areas. Streets near the harbor mouth deal with water coming from below as well as above. During heavy rains, undersized sump pumps get overwhelmed and contaminated water saturates crawlspaces. Cleanup here requires category 3 water protocols, not just drying.
Pricing for Water Damage Restoration in San Pedro, CA
San Pedro’s market reflects the older housing stock and coastal environment. Emergency water extraction typically runs $950-$1,700 depending on the square footage and water class. Structural drying and dehumidification adds $1,200-$2,400 for a standard single-room event, with longer runs in plaster homes for the reasons above. Flood cleanup involving contaminated water starts around $2,500 and scales with affected area. Burst pipe restoration with drywall repair and repainting runs $1,800-$3,600. The salt-corrosion variable here is real: when hidden fastener damage emerges, structural stabilization adds to scope, and we’ll quote it in writing before we do the work. Estimates are free. The marine layer keeps San Pedro’s relative humidity measurably higher than the LA Basin interior for much of the year, which means structural drying typically runs 20-40% longer here than in Torrance or Carson. We account for this by setting extended drying goals, using Dri-Eaz desiccant and low-grain refrigerant systems, and taking daily moisture readings until the dry standard is met - not a day before. Flood cleanup near the harbor mouth and the Port of Los Angeles frequently involves category 3 water - storm-surge, tidal backflow, or seawater mixed with petroleum residue from port operations. That’s contaminated water, and the cleanup protocol is different: containment, removal of affected drywall and flooring, sanitizing, and then the drying sequence. San Pedro’s older homes in these streets also tend to have undersized sump pumps that fail during the exact event that flooded them.
